How to sort a Python dictionary by value?

Python dictionaries are a powerful data structure that allows you to store key-value pairs. However, dictionaries are unordered by nature, which means the elements are not sorted. Sometimes, though, we may want to sort a dictionary by its values. Sorting a dictionary in this way can be useful in many scenarios, such as finding the most frequent words in a text or sorting a dictionary of names by their popularity. In this article, we will explore different methods to sort a Python dictionary by value.

Method 1: Using the sorted() Function with a lambda function

One straightforward way to sort a dictionary by value is by using the sorted() function along with a lambda function. Here’s how it works:

“`python
# Create a sample dictionary
my_dict = {“apple”: 5, “banana”: 2, “cherry”: 8, “date”: 3, “elderberry”: 1}

# Sort the dictionary by value
sorted_dict = dict(sorted(my_dict.items(), key=lambda x: x[1]))

print(sorted_dict)
“`

The code above sorts the dictionary `my_dict` by its values by passing `my_dict.items()` and a lambda function to the `sorted()` function. The lambda function specifies that we want to sort the items based on the second element (`x[1]`) of each tuple in the dictionary.

Related or Similar FAQs:

1. Can you sort a Python dictionary by key instead?

Yes, you can sort a dictionary by key using similar approaches, such as passing `my_dict.items()` to the sorted() function without specifying a lambda function.

2. What happens if two values in the dictionary are the same?

If two values are the same, Python will maintain the original order of the items in the dictionary.

3. Can I sort the dictionary in descending order?

Yes, by using the `reverse=True` parameter, you can sort the dictionary in descending order. For example:

“`python
sorted_dict = dict(sorted(my_dict.items(), key=lambda x: x[1], reverse=True))
“`

5. How can I preserve the sorted order of the dictionary?

In Python, regular dictionaries do not guarantee a specific order. To preserve the sorted order, you can use the `collections.OrderedDict` class.

6. Can I sort the dictionary using the keys in reverse order?

Yes, you can sort the dictionary using the keys in reverse order by passing `key=lambda x: x[0], reverse=True` to the sorted() function.

10. How can I sort a dictionary based on both key and value?

If you want to sort a dictionary based on both key and value, you can modify the lambda function to sort by both elements of each tuple, like `key=lambda x: (x[1], x[0])`.
